2. Complexity
Developing robust tracking systems that can establish unified individual profiles across gadgets is a major difficulty. Customers commonly begin a trip on one tool, after that switch over to an additional to finish it, causing fragmented accounts and imprecise information.
Deterministic cross-device acknowledgment versions can conquer this trouble by sewing individuals with each other utilizing understood, conclusive identifiers like an e-mail address or cookie ID. Nevertheless, this technique isn't sure-fire and depends on individuals being logged in on every device. Additionally, data privacy regulations such as GDPR and CCPA make it difficult to track customers without their authorization. This makes relying upon probabilistic monitoring approaches extra intricate. Luckily, methods such as incrementality screening can assist online marketers conquer these challenges. They allow them to gain an extra exact photo of the client journey, enabling them to make the most of ROI on their paid marketing campaigns.

4. Scalability
Unlike single-device acknowledgment, which counts on web cookies, cross-device acknowledgment needs unified individual IDs to track touchpoints and conversions. Without this, users' information is fragmented, and online marketers can not accurately examine marketing efficiency.
Identity resolution devices like deterministic monitoring or probabilistic matching help marketing professionals link device-level information to distinct user accounts. However, these approaches require that customers be logged in to all tools and platforms, which is usually unwise for mobile consumers. Moreover, privacy conformity regulations such as GDPR and CCPA limit these tracking abilities.
The good news is that alternate methods are resolving this challenge. AI-powered acknowledgment models, for instance, leverage huge datasets to uncover nuanced patterns and expose hidden understandings within intricate multi-device journeys. By utilizing these technologies, marketing experts can build extra scalable and accurate cross-device acknowledgment solutions.
